Overview

As a Rural Generalist Podiatrist you will contribute to the delivery of a comprehensive and integrated range of health services. To achieve this you will work as a member of a multidisciplinary team including health professionals and service providers from other sectors. You will utilise a combination preventative early intervention treatment/therapy and evaluation approaches including individual therapy group programs health promotion and community development projects. You will adopt a proactive approach to developing and maintaining contemporary knowledge and skills in podiatry growing your skillset in rural general healthcare. Make a real difference and feel like an important part of the community. Being part of Barossa Hills Fleurieu Local Health Network means you will be supported both personally and professionally can take advantage of education and training opportunities will have access to flexible working hours and be part of an inter-professional approach to holistic health care.

The incumbent may be required to provide a regional service to more than one community within the Barossa Hills Fleurieu region on a regular and rostered schedule.

You must hold a recognised qualification in the Podiatry profession and be eligible for practicing membership with the Australian Health Practitioner Regulation Agency (AHPRA) Podiatry Board. You will be skilled in providing straightforward clinical podiatry services including one-on-one group and health promotion activities. Strong communication and teamwork skills will be essential. You will be capable of supporting consumers through the patient journey providing effective assessment timely referrals accurate information coordinated care and prompt follow-up.
